Xiaomi smartphone prices in 2026: from Redmi to flagships

Xiaomi’s smartphone lineup is divided into three segments: budget Redmi, mid-budget POCO premium Xiaomi/Mi. The difference in price between them can be 100 000 RUB, while even the cheapest models are often equipped with modern chips (for example, Snapdragon). 4 Gen 2 redmi 12). Below are the current prices for popular models in Russia (as of June) 2026 year-end).

It is important to take into account that official dealers (M.Video, Svyaznoy) sell devices with Russian firmware and a 12+ month warranty, while on AliExpress or in the telegram channels of β€œgray” imports you can find the same models 15-25% cheaper – but with global firmware and the risk of problems with warranty service.

  • πŸ“± Redmi 12 (4/128 GB): 12 990–15 500 β‚½ (officially) / 9 500–11 000 β‚½ ("grey-import)
  • πŸ“± POCO X6 Pro (8/256 GB): 24 990–27 990 β‚½ (officially) / 18 000–21 000 β‚½ (AliExpress)
  • πŸ“± Xiaomi 14 (12/256 GB): 69 990–74 990 β‚½ (officially) / 55 000–62 000 β‚½ (parallel importation)
  • πŸ“± Xiaomi 14 Ultra (16/512 GB): 119 990–129 990 β‚½ (only official dealers)

⚠️ Attention: Xiaomi smartphones with prefix 5G In the name (for example, Redmi Note 12) 5G) In Russia, they are often sold without local band support. 5G (n78, n79). Before buying, check the specifications on the site mi.com - otherwise you risk getting a device that will not catch the next generation network.

2.How much are Xiaomi TVs: from Mi TV A2 before QLED-flagship

Xiaomi TVs are traditionally cheaper than competitors (Samsung, LG) And they have similar characteristics. TV Q2 55" with matrix QLED And 120Hz support costs about 50,000. β‚½, Similar models of Samsung Q60C It'll cost 70,000.+ β‚½. However, there are pitfalls: many models are sold without legs (only with a wall mount), and in budget series (Mi). TV A2) Dolby Vision is often missing.

Xiaomi TV prices are highly dependent on the diagonal and matrix type, and below is a comparison of popular models in Russia (prices are indicated for the leg version, if applicable):

  • πŸ“Ί Mi TV A2 43" (Full HD, 60 Hz): 22,990-25,990 β‚½
  • πŸ“Ί Mi TV P1 55" (4K, 120Hz, Dolby Vision: 44,990–49,990 β‚½
  • πŸ“Ί Mi TV Q2 65" (QLED, 120 Hz, 2Γ—HDMI 2.1): 69 990–74 990 β‚½
  • πŸ“Ί Mi TV Master 77" (OLED, 4K, 120 Hz): 149,990–159,990 β‚½

⚠️ Note: Xiaomi TVs purchased on AliExpress may have Chinese firmware with a limited set of apps (no Netflix, YouTube in the app). 4K). To avoid problems, look for models marked Global Version or ask the seller to confirm support for Google Play.

3.Smart watches and fitness bracelets: prices for Mi Band, Watch and Smart Band

Xiaomi wearables are one of the most affordable on the market, like the Mi Band 8 fitness bracelet with the AMOLED-The screen and sleep monitoring costs only 3,500-4,500 β‚½, While similar devices from Huawei or Samsung will cost 2-3 times more, there is a nuance here: many features, for example, SpO2 Stress test in budget models work with an error of up to 15%.

Prices for Xiaomi smart watches and bracelets in 2026:

  • ⌚ Mi Band 8 (base version): 3,490–4,200 β‚½
  • ⌚ Mi Band 8 Pro (GPS, NFC): 5 990–6 800 β‚½
  • ⌚ Xiaomi Watch 2 Pro (Wear OS, 4G): 19 990–22 990 β‚½
  • ⌚ Xiaomi Smart Band 7 Pro (AMOLED, 14 days of autonomy: 4,990–5,500 β‚½

How to distinguish the original Mi Band from a fake?
The original Mi Band bracelet has a: 1. Xiaomi logo on the back of the case (laser engraving, not sticker). 2. Hologram packaging and QR-code-checker mi.com/verify. 3. Firmware with support for Russian (fakes are often only English / Chinese). 4. Box with the seal of the official distributor (for Russia - LLC "Xiomi RU").

6 Hidden Costs: What Will Increase Xiaomi’s Total Value

When buying Xiaomi equipment, many forget about the additional costs that can increase the total amount by 10-50%. For example, a Xiaomi 14 smartphone without a charger will cost $ 2,000. β‚½ cheaper, but original power supply 120W You will have to buy it separately for 2,500. β‚½. And Mi's TV. TV Q2 Without a leg, it'll save you $3,000. β‚½, But mounting on the wall will cost 1,500-2,000 β‚½.

Typical "hidden" expenses:

  • πŸ”Œ Chargers and cables: Official power supply 67W For the Redmi Note 13 Pro+ It costs 1,800. β‚½, cable USB-C β€” 900 β‚½.
  • πŸ›‘οΈ Warranty extension: Official stores offer to extend the warranty on the smartphone up to 24 months for 2,000-4000 β‚½.
  • πŸ“¦ Delivery and customs clearance: AliExpress may charge a fee of 15-30% of the cost (if the order is made) > 200 €).
  • πŸ”§ Repairs and accessories: Replacing the screen on Xiaomi 13T The service center will cost 15,000-20000 β‚½, case + glass - another 1,500 β‚½.

⚠️ Note: When buying Xiaomi on AliExpress marked "No Tax", be prepared for the fact that the parcel can be detained at customs. In 2026, the FCS of the Russian Federation tightened control over parcels from China, and the probability of additional charging of duties increased to 40% (versus 15% in 2023 m).

FAQ: Frequent questions about Xiaomi pricing

πŸ” Why Xiaomi is cheaper on AliExpress than in Russia?
Prices are lower due to the lack of taxes (VAT, excise duties), cheap logistics and direct delivery from factories, but gray devices are often not certified for Russia, which can lead to problems with warranty or network operation (for example, the lack of support for 5G bands for Russian operators).
πŸ“± Can you trust Xiaomi sellers in Telegram?
Risk is high: 30% of the sellers on Telegram are scammers who disappear after prepayment. If you decide to buy, follow the rules: Check the reviews in chat (not in screenshots!). Demand video with the device (IMEI must match the box); Pay only upon receipt (a cash-on or secure transaction through the bank); Better choose sellers with a proven reputation (for example, channels with 10,000+ subscribers and a history of transactions from 1+ year).
πŸ’° How to Refund VAT When Buying Xiaomi Abroad?
If you buy Xiaomi in the European Union (e.g. Germany or Poland), you can refund up to 20% VAT through the Tax Free system. To do this: Ask the store for a Tax Free check (the minimum purchase amount is usually 50–100 €). Seal customs at the airport when departing the EU. Send the documents to an intermediary company (e.g. Global Blue) for a refund. On average, you can refund 10–15% of the cost of the device. For example, when buying Xiaomi 14 for 800 €, you will get back ~120 €.
πŸ”§ Should I Buy a Xiaomi B/A?
Buying used Xiaomi devices is justified only in two cases: the device is sold with a check and a valid warranty (residue from 6).+ Price below market by 40 months%+ (for example, Xiaomi 12T $25,000 β‚½ 40,000 β‚½). Dangers: ❌ The battery may be worn out (check in ##4636## β†’ "Battery status"). ❌ The device may be on the blacklist for IMEI (Check on sndeep.info). ❌ There is no warranty for repair (even if the device is warranty, it does not pass to the new owner).
